Cita/ Kadala vs Agassiz, Bc Climate & Distance Between

Canada flag
  • The distance between Cita/ Kadala, Russia and Agassiz, Bc, Canada is approximately 7,601 km or 4,723 mi.
  • To reach Cita/ Kadala in this distance one would set out from Agassiz, Bc bearing 327.1°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Cita/ Kadala bearing 215.2° or SW .
  • Cita/ Kadala has a boreal subarctic climate with dry winters (Dwc) whereas Agassiz, Bc has a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
  • Cita/ Kadala is in or near the boreal moist forest biome whereas Agassiz, Bc is in or near the cool temperate wet forest biome.
  • The mean annual temperature is 12.8 °C (23°F) cooler.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 27.7 °C (49.9°F) more in Cita/ Kadala.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to truly oceanic.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 1385.1 mm (54.5 in) less which is equivalent to 1385.1 l/m² (33.99 US gal/ft²) or 13,851,000 l/ha (1,480,764 US gal/ac) less. About 1/5 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 2.9° lower in Cita/ Kadala than in Agassiz, Bc.
